Transmitter Nordkirchen

Encyclopedia : T : TR : TRA : Transmitter Nordkirchen


The transmitter Nordkirchen is a facility for transmitting the program of "Deutschlandfunk" on 549 kHz with a power of 100 kilowatts, near Nordkirchen, Germany. The transmitter Nordkirchen was established in 1980 and uses as aerials two steel framwork masts, which are insulated against ground, with a height of 99.5 metres.
